A bit of History, Nuns in the Nemiusklooster (from the internet) The name of the hotel, de Soete Moeder, refers to Sweet Mother Mary, patroness of ‘s-Hertogenbosch and of the Nemiusklooster (the convent) that was built between 1928 and 1929. Apart from having occupied the convent for 75 years, the nuns also provided care and education in the convent and its surrounding neighbourhood. This adds an extra dimension to the convent building. The Nemiusklooster originally constituted an ensemble, consisting of a church, a home for the elderly, a vicarage, a patronage building and a girls’ and nursery school. A push in the right direction De Soete Moeder no longer functions as a religious institute, but unites the social engagement of the Sisters of Love with something new: monastery hotel de Soete Moeder as patroness of vulnerable young people. The monastery hotel is more than a special location where guests flourish. It is our mission to offer young people such as job-seekers, dropouts and students looking for a work placement an opportunity to learn and gain work experience. Founders Adri and Eline have taken over the social and civic role of the nuns.
